    Default humminbird temp question


    i know this is a dumb question probally but what does the 58 and 38 on the temp mean ,thanks:o

    That is the Temperature Graph feature you are talking about. It can be found under the Sonar menu tab and can be turned off or on. The 58 and 38 is the range of the Temperature Graph.
